Why Product Range Matters to Hardware Stores
Customers rarely buy tools in isolation. A customer purchasing a cordless drill may also need drill bits, screwdriver bits, sockets, measuring tools, or a tool storage box.
A mechanic may need pliers, wrenches, hex keys, screwdrivers, and socket sets. A contractor may need a complete tool kit instead of several separate products.
This creates an opportunity for retailers to build connected product groups rather than selling unrelated items.

Power Tools
Power tools attract customers who want to complete tasks faster and with less physical effort.
GREENER’s current product structure includes drills and rotary hammers, impact drivers and wrenches, cutting and grinding tools, and blowers and vacuums.
When selling power tools, retailers should provide clear information about:
- Intended application
- Power source
- Tool size
- Included accessories
- Operating requirements
- Safety instructions
- Warranty and after-sales support
A common problem in the power tool market is that users purchase a tool without understanding which accessories or specifications they need. Product pages should therefore explain the complete use case instead of focusing only on appearance.

Why Tool Accessories Create Repeat Demand
Tool accessories are often purchased more frequently than the main tool itself.
Drill bits wear out. Screwdriver bits can be lost. Socket sizes may need to be expanded. Rivet tools may require additional accessories for different applications.

What Retailers Should Check Before Choosing a Supplier
A competitive price is important, but it is not the only factor.
Retailers should also evaluate:
- Product consistency between batches
- Packaging quality
- Available product categories
- Minimum order requirements
- OEM and ODM support
- Quality inspection procedures
- Communication speed
- Spare parts or after-sales support
- Shipping experience
- Product images and technical information
A supplier with a broad catalog can reduce the need to coordinate with multiple factories. However, product range should not come at the expense of quality control.
